From e3804feab5c63af6a2c5a7939f2358772e28b5fd Mon Sep 17 00:00:00 2001
From: czt <czt18638530771@163.com>
Date: 星期三, 04 十二月 2024 11:09:19 +0800
Subject: [PATCH] 调整广东1213-封仓确认单接口
---
/dev/null | 58 -----------------------------
src/main/java/com/fzzy/push/gd2023/GD2023ApiRemoteService2023.java | 38 +++++-------------
src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api1213.java | 13 +++---
src/main/java/com/fzzy/push/gd2023/ApiCodeConstant.java | 8 ++--
src/main/java/com/fzzy/api/entity/Api1213.java | 2
5 files changed, 23 insertions(+), 96 deletions(-)
diff --git a/src/main/java/com/fzzy/api/entity/Api1213.java b/src/main/java/com/fzzy/api/entity/Api1213.java
index 754ffe1..e7d4c31 100644
--- a/src/main/java/com/fzzy/api/entity/Api1213.java
+++ b/src/main/java/com/fzzy/api/entity/Api1213.java
@@ -20,7 +20,7 @@
@Table(name = "API_1213")
public class Api1213 implements Serializable {
- public static String SORT_PROP = "fcrq";
+ public static String SORT_PROP = "fcqrdh";
@Id
@PropertyDef(label = "灏佷粨纭鍗曞彿", description = "2浣嶄笟鍔$紪鐮�(21浠h〃灏佷粨)+yyMMdd+4浣嶉『搴忕爜锛�212405040001")
diff --git a/src/main/java/com/fzzy/push/gd2023/ApiCodeConstant.java b/src/main/java/com/fzzy/push/gd2023/ApiCodeConstant.java
index 027e110..8d3f74d 100644
--- a/src/main/java/com/fzzy/push/gd2023/ApiCodeConstant.java
+++ b/src/main/java/com/fzzy/push/gd2023/ApiCodeConstant.java
@@ -5,10 +5,6 @@
*/
public class ApiCodeConstant {
-
- public static String API_1023 = "1023";
- public static String API_2001 = "2001";
- public static String API_2002 = "2002";
/**
* 鎺ュ彛缂栫爜-1001 韬唤璁よ瘉鎺ュ彛
*/
@@ -179,6 +175,10 @@
*/
public static String API_CODE_QYXYXX = "qyxyxx";
/**
+ * 鎺ュ彛缂栫爜-1041 璐㈠姟鎶ヨ〃淇℃伅鎺ュ彛
+ */
+ public static String API_CODE_FCQRD = "fcqrd";
+ /**
* 鎺ュ彛缂栫爜-1042 鏂囦欢涓婁紶鎺ュ彛
*/
public static String API_CODE_WJSC = "upload";
diff --git a/src/main/java/com/fzzy/push/gd2023/GD2023ApiRemoteService2023.java b/src/main/java/com/fzzy/push/gd2023/GD2023ApiRemoteService2023.java
index fda9c26..8fae9e4 100644
--- a/src/main/java/com/fzzy/push/gd2023/GD2023ApiRemoteService2023.java
+++ b/src/main/java/com/fzzy/push/gd2023/GD2023ApiRemoteService2023.java
@@ -903,36 +903,18 @@
apiData.setZhgxsj(DateUtils.addSeconds(new Date(), -10));
return JSON.toJSONString(apiData);
}
- if (ApiCodeConstant.API_2001.equals(inteId)) {
- Gd2023Api2001 apiData = new Gd2023Api2001();
- BeanUtils.copyProperties(data, apiData);
+ if (Constant.API_CODE_1213.equals(inteId)) {
+ Api1213 api1213 = (Api1213)data;
+ Gd2023Api1213 apiData = new Gd2023Api1213();
+ BeanUtils.copyProperties(api1213, apiData);
//鏍¢獙缁熶竴缂栫爜鏄惁涓虹┖锛屼负绌哄垯鏌ヨ淇℃伅杩涜璧嬪��
- if ("0".equals(apiData.getTycfbm()) || StringUtils.isEmpty(apiData.getTycfbm())) {
- String tycfbm = apiCommonService.getTycfbm(apiData.getCfdm());
- apiData.setTycfbm(tycfbm);
- }
- //鏍¢獙缁熶竴缂栫爜鏄惁涓虹┖锛屼负绌哄垯鏌ヨ淇℃伅杩涜璧嬪��
- if ("0".equals(apiData.getTycfbm()) || StringUtils.isEmpty(apiData.getTycfbm())) {
- String tycfbm = apiCommonService.getTycfbm(apiData.getCfdm());
- apiData.setTycfbm(tycfbm);
+ if ("0".equals(apiData.getTyhwbm()) || StringUtils.isEmpty(apiData.getTyhwbm())) {
+ String tyhwbm = apiCommonService.getTyhwbm(apiData.getHwdm());
+ apiData.setTyhwbm(tyhwbm);
}
apiData.setZhgxsj(DateUtils.addSeconds(new Date(), -10));
- return JSON.toJSONString(apiData);
- }
- if (ApiCodeConstant.API_2002.equals(inteId)) {
- Gd2023Api2002 apiData = new Gd2023Api2002();
- BeanUtils.copyProperties(data, apiData);
- //鏍¢獙缁熶竴缂栫爜鏄惁涓虹┖锛屼负绌哄垯鏌ヨ淇℃伅杩涜璧嬪��
- if ("0".equals(apiData.getTycfbm()) || StringUtils.isEmpty(apiData.getTycfbm())) {
- String tycfbm = apiCommonService.getTycfbm(apiData.getCfdm());
- apiData.setTycfbm(tycfbm);
- }
- //鏍¢獙缁熶竴缂栫爜鏄惁涓虹┖锛屼负绌哄垯鏌ヨ淇℃伅杩涜璧嬪��
- if ("0".equals(apiData.getTyajbm()) || StringUtils.isEmpty(apiData.getTyajbm())) {
- String tyajbm = apiCommonService.getTyajbm(apiData.getAjdm());
- apiData.setTyajbm(tyajbm);
- }
- apiData.setZhgxsj(DateUtils.addSeconds(new Date(), -10));
+ apiData.setFcsl(api1213.getFcsl());
+ apiData.setFcsrq(api1213.getFcsqr());
return JSON.toJSONString(apiData);
}
return JSON.toJSONString(data);
@@ -1227,6 +1209,8 @@
return com.fzzy.push.gd2023.ApiCodeConstant.API_CODE_ZMKCXX;
case "1212":
return com.fzzy.push.gd2023.ApiCodeConstant.API_CODE_KHXX;
+ case "1213":
+ return com.fzzy.push.gd2023.ApiCodeConstant.API_CODE_FCQRD;
case "1301":
return com.fzzy.push.gd2023.ApiCodeConstant.API_CODE_AQGL;
case "1302":
diff --git a/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2001.java b/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api1213.java
similarity index 86%
rename from src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2001.java
rename to src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api1213.java
index 94feba6..4529edc 100644
--- a/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2001.java
+++ b/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api1213.java
@@ -5,6 +5,7 @@
import com.fasterxml.jackson.annotation.JsonProperty;
import lombok.Data;
+import javax.persistence.Column;
import java.io.Serializable;
import java.util.Date;
@@ -14,18 +15,18 @@
* @Date 2024/6/29 14:36
*/
@Data
-public class Gd2023Api2001 implements Serializable {
+public class Gd2023Api1213 implements Serializable {
private static final long serialVersionUID = 9157617424050247565L;
@PropertyDef(label = "灏佷粨纭鍗曞彿", description = "2浣嶄笟鍔$紪鐮�(21浠h〃灏佷粨)+yyyyMMdd+4浣嶉『搴忕爜锛�21202405040001")
private String fcqrdh;
- @PropertyDef(label = "浠撴埧浠g爜" )
- private String cfdm;
+ @PropertyDef(label = "璐т綅浠g爜" )
+ private String hwdm;
- @PropertyDef(label = "缁熶竴浠撴埧缂栫爜")
- private String tycfbm;
+ @PropertyDef(label = "缁熶竴璐т綅缂栫爜")
+ private String tyhwbm;
@PropertyDef(label = "灏佷粨鏃ユ湡")
@JSONField(format = "yyyy-MM-dd")
@@ -54,7 +55,7 @@
@PropertyDef(label = "灏佷粨鏁伴噺")
@JsonProperty("Fcsl")
- private String Fcsl;
+ private Double Fcsl;
@PropertyDef(label = "灏佷粨鐢宠浜�")
private String fcsrq;
diff --git a/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2002.java b/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2002.java
deleted file mode 100644
index 290a0c0..0000000
--- a/src/main/java/com/fzzy/push/gd2023/dto/Gd2023Api2002.java
+++ /dev/null
@@ -1,58 +0,0 @@
-package com.fzzy.push.gd2023.dto;
-
-import com.alibaba.fastjson.annotation.JSONField;
-import com.bstek.dorado.annotation.PropertyDef;
-import lombok.Data;
-
-import java.io.Serializable;
-import java.util.Date;
-
-/**
- * @Description 鍑烘竻纭鍗�
- * @Author CZT
- * @Date 2024/6/29 14:54
- */
-@Data
-public class Gd2023Api2002 implements Serializable {
-
- private static final long serialVersionUID = 9157617424050247565L;
-
- @PropertyDef(label = "鍑烘竻纭鍗曞彿", description = "2浣嶄笟鍔$紪鐮�(22浠h〃鍑烘竻)+yyyyMMdd+4浣嶉『搴忕爜锛�22202405040001")
- private String cqqrdh;
-
- @PropertyDef(label = "浠撴埧浠g爜" )
- private String cfdm;
-
- @PropertyDef(label = "缁熶竴浠撴埧缂栫爜")
- private String tycfbm;
-
- @PropertyDef(label = "寤掗棿浠g爜")
- private String ajdm;
-
- @PropertyDef(label = "缁熶竴寤掗棿缂栫爜")
- private String tyajbm;
-
- @PropertyDef(label = "鍑烘竻鏃ユ湡")
- @JSONField(format = "yyyy-MM-dd")
- private Date cqrq;
-
- @PropertyDef(label = "鐢宠浜�")
- private String srq;
-
- @PropertyDef(label = "閮ㄩ棬瀹℃牳浜�")
- private String bmshr;
-
- @PropertyDef(label = "棰嗗瀹℃牳浜�")
- private String ldshr;
-
- @PropertyDef(label = "澶囨敞")
- private String bz;
-
- @PropertyDef(label = "鎿嶄綔鏍囧織")
- private String czbz;
-
- @PropertyDef(label = "鏈�鍚庢洿鏂版椂闂�")
- @JSONField(format = "yyyy-MM-dd HH:mm:ss")
- private Date zhgxsj;
-
-}
--
Gitblit v1.9.3